INTELLIGENT KEY BUTTONS INOPERATIVE
BUT REQUEST SWITCHES WORK
This bulletin has been amended in the Title and SERVICE INFORMATION section,
including step 2a on page 3. Discard all previous versions of this bulletin.
APPLIED VEHICLES:
2015 Altima (L33)
2015 Pathfinder (R52)
2015 Murano (Z52)
SERVICE INFORMATION
If it appears, for any or all of the Intelligent Keys on an applied vehicle, that all “RKE”
lock/unlock/panic/trunk button functions of that specific Intelligent Key(s) does not work
BUT
The doors will lock and unlock when pressing either front door request switch while using
the particular Intelligent Key(s) (see Figure 1 below),
Hands-free functions such as request
switch will operate as designed
Figure 1
THEN
That specific Intelligent Key may have become de-synchronized with the vehicle.
NOTE:
 Intelligent Key de-synchronization may occur if the Intelligent Key is not used for
extended periods of time or if the Intelligent Key was not operating due to low battery
condition and the battery has been replaced.
 Do NOT replace the BCM, Intelligent Key, or any other parts if an Intelligent Key only
needs to be re-synchronized.

To Test Intelligent Key Synchronization:
1. Place the incident Intelligent Key outside the vehicle (minimum distance – 10 feet) to
avoid detection of the Intelligent Key by the vehicle. See Figure 2 below.
Figure 2

NOTE: Steps 2a, b, & c MUST be done in close time and sequence together in order for
the test to be performed correctly.
2a. Open the door, enter the vehicle, and then close the door. Press the ignition button, and
then immediately perform step 2b.

At this time, due to no Intelligent Key in or around the vehicle, the BCM will activate
only the ignition switch antenna.
Ignition switch antenna will become
active and will transmit a signal to
detect any Intelligent Key in range
Figure 3
2b. WITHIN 30 SECONDS of step 2a above, FIRST have an associate hand the Intelligent
Key to you, THEN immediately perform step 2c.
Have an associate deliver
the incident Intelligent Key
WITHOUT HAVING TO
OPEN THE DOOR
Figure 4
2c. Place the Intelligent Key next to the ignition button as shown in Figure 5 below
(emblems align with center of buttons). Do not depress the ignition button.
Place Intelligent Key next to
ignition button and wait for tones
Figure 5

If two short tones are heard, the Intelligent Key was de-synchronized but is now
re-synchronized and should function normally again. See step 3, Figure 6 (next
page).

If no tones are heard and the Intelligent Key buttons still do not work, refer to ASIST
or the applicable Electronic Service Manual for further diagnosis.

3. At this time, “PUSH BRAKE AND START BUTTON TO DRIVE” will be seen in the
vehicle information display in the combination meter (see Figure 6 and 7).
Figure 6
Figure 7
4. Confirm Intelligent Key operation by testing all the buttons.
